This indicates that the brand-new company (or its wholly possessed subsidiaries) must itself be the company of the certifying employees. For a new business situated within a local center, the brand-new business enterprise can directly or indirectly develop the permanent settings. Up to 90% of the work development need for regional facility investors may be satisfied using indirect work.Indirect tasks are held beyond the new business yet are produced as a result of the brand-new commercial venture. When it comes to a distressed organization, the EB-5 investor may rely on task upkeep. The investor must show that the variety of existing workers is, or will certainly be, no much less than the pre-investment level for a duration of at the very least 2 years.
The loss for this duration have to be at least 20% of the troubled organization' net worth before the loss. When determining whether the struggling business has been in existence for 2 years, USCIS will take into consideration followers in interest to the struggling company when examining whether they have actually remained in presence for the very same time period as business they did well.
Jobs that are recurring, short-lived, seasonal, or short-term do not certify as permanent full-time jobs. However, work that are expected to last at the very least 2 years are generally not taken into consideration recurring, momentary, seasonal, or short-term. Capital implies money and all genuine, personal, or blended substantial properties had and managed by the immigrant financier.

The typical minimum investment quantity has raised to $1.8 million (from $1 million) to make up rising cost of living (EB5 Investment Immigration). The minimal investment in a TEA has actually enhanced to $900,000 (from $500,000) to account for inflation. Future changes will additionally be tied to rising cost of living (per the Customer Price Index for All Urban Consumers, or CPI-U) and take place every 5 years

United state migration law makes visas available to immigrant capitalists seeking to get in the USA to participate in new business that benefit the U.S. economy via task production and capital expense. E5 capitalists get approximately 7.1 percent of all employment based immigrant visas issued around the world each year. To qualify as an immigrant capitalist for applications filed on or after November 21, 2019, an international national have to spend, without borrowing, the adhering to minimum qualifying resources dollar quantities in a qualifying business: $1,000,000 (U.S.); or $500,000 (UNITED STATE) in a high-unemployment or rural location, considered a targeted employment area.
citizens, legal irreversible citizens, or other immigrants accredited to work in the USA, not including the financier and the investor's partner, sons, or children. Immigrant investor visa groups are: Employment production outside a targeted location C5 Employment production in a targeted rural/high unemployment area T5 Financier Pilot Program not in a targeted location R5 Capitalist Pilot Program in a targeted area I5 After USCIS authorizes the application, it advice is sent to the National Visa Center (NVC).
When an applicant's priority day fulfills one of the most current qualifying date, NVC will certainly advise the candidate to total Form DS-261, Selection of Address and Representative. (KEEP IN MIND: If you already have an attorney, NVC will certainly not instruct you to full Form DS-261). NVC will begin pre-processing the candidate's case by giving the applicant with directions to send the suitable costs.

Immigrant visas can not be issued up until a candidate's concern date is reached. In certain greatly oversubscribed groups, there may be a waiting period of numerous years before a top priority day is reached.
